GE Aviation scouts for MRO ally in India

Mumbai: GE Aviation, one of the world's leading manufacturers of jet engines for civil and military aircraft, plans strategic tieups with suppliers from India for sourcing of materials.
The firm is also looking at establishing relationships with Air-India and Indian Airlines for local engine ma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) facilities.
GE had early committed $20 million investment in an engine shop as part of a $8.1 billion deal by Air-India to acquire 68 airplanes from Boeing.
GE will be supplying engines to Air-India for this mega deal.
For Jet Airways, GE has committed initial deliveries of the CF6-80E engine for the Airbus A330 fleet by March 2007.
